Common Warning Lights and Interpretations



Determine usual warning lights in your car and comprehend their significances to ensure secure driving.

The most normal warning lights include the check engine light, which indicates concerns with the engine or discharges system. If this light begins, it's essential to have your automobile inspected immediately.

The oil stress cautioning light indicates reduced oil stress, calling for prompt focus to stop engine damage.

A flashing battery light might suggest a faulty billing system, possibly leaving you stranded if not resolved.

The tire stress tracking system (TPMS) light notifies you to low tire pressure, influencing car security and gas effectiveness. Ignoring https://squareblogs.net/maurine31ted/eco-friendly-vehicle-detailing-lasting-products-and-techniques can result in unsafe driving problems.

The abdominal light shows a trouble with the anti-lock braking system, endangering your capability to stop promptly in emergencies.

Last but not least, the coolant temperature alerting light warns of engine overheating, which can cause extreme damage if not solved swiftly.

Understanding these common warning lights will certainly aid you deal with concerns quickly and preserve safe driving conditions.

Do It Yourself Troubleshooting Tips



If you discover a warning light on your dashboard, there are a couple of do it yourself repairing suggestions you can try prior to seeking expert aid.

The primary step is to consult your cars and truck's handbook to comprehend what the particular warning light suggests. Occasionally the problem can be as basic as a loose gas cap causing the check engine light. Tightening up the gas cap may settle the trouble.

One more common problem is a low battery, which can activate different cautioning lights. Checking the battery links for deterioration and guaranteeing they're secure might deal with the trouble.



If a warning light persists, you can attempt resetting it by separating the auto's battery for a few minutes and after that reconnecting it. Additionally, checking your car's fluid degrees, such as oil, coolant, and brake fluid, can assist troubleshoot alerting lights associated with these systems.
